Objective of the Game
In Entdecker, the objective is for players to gather the most points by exploring lands and seas and making valuable discoveries.
Game Components
- Game Board: A grid on which discoveries are made.
- Explorer Tiles: Square tiles that represent different landscapes, seas, or discovery stations.
- Game Pieces/Ships: For each player to explore and mark.
- Markers: For scoring and controlling discoveries.
- Score Cards: For managing the points.
Setup
- Place the game board in the center of the table.
- Shuffle all explorer tiles and place them face down as a draw pile.
- Each player chooses a color and receives the corresponding game pieces and a marker.
- Keep the score cards handy.
Game Play
The game progresses in rounds, which are divided into the following phases:
- Reveal Tile:
- The current player draws an explorer tile and reveals it.
-
The revealed tile must be placed on the grid board, connecting with at least one side to an adjacent tile.
-
Place Game Pieces:
-
After placing a tile, the player may place one of their game pieces on the tile to claim it. Players cannot place on tiles lying in the sea.
-
Complete Discoveries:
-
When a region of connected land tiles is fully enclosed, it is scored. The player with the most game pieces on this region receives the most points, while other players with pieces on the region receive fewer points.
-
Count Points:
-
The player scores points based on the size of the completed region and collected discoveries.
-
Markers Placement:
-
The player marks their points on the score track with their marker.
-
Turn Change:
- The next player repeats the steps.
Game Ending
The game ends when no explorer tiles are left. The player with the most points on the score track wins the game.
Strategic Tips
- Tile Placement Selection: Place tiles such that you can gain future scoring areas.
- Resource Management: Deploy your game pieces strategically; save one for significant discoveries.
- Tactical Use of Region Completion: Sometimes complete regions for fewer points to deny other players from gaining points.
